The GD25LD10CEIGR utilizes the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I) to communicate with the host device. It stores digital information in non-volatile memory cells that retain data even when power is disconnected. The SPI interface allows for high-speed data transfer between the host device and the flash memory. The memory can be erased at the sector level and programmed at the byte or page level.
